“ The deduction for income tax purposes stands on no better footing. Congress permitted a deduction of that part of gross income 'which pursuant to the terms of the will * * * is during the taxable year * * * permanently set aside' for charitable purposes. In view of the explicit requirement that the income be permanently set aside, there is certainly no more occasion here than in the case of the estate tax to permit deduction of sums whose ultimate charitable destination is so uncertain. ”
